Spring Cloud是一系列框架的集合,用于构建微服务应用。与Spring Boot的关系如下:1、基于Spring Boot: Spring Cloud建立在Spring Boot的基础上,利用其特性来简化分布式系统开发。2、微服务工具集: Spring Cloud为微服务架构提供了一整套的解决方案,如服务发现、配置管理、消息路由等。3、依赖管理: Spring Cloud依赖Sp...
Spring Boot 和 Spring Cloud 在微服务架构中扮演着互补的角色。Spring Boot 专注于快速开发单个微服务,...
Spring Cloud基于Spring Boot,为微服务体系开发中的架构问题,提供了一整套的解决方案——服务注册与发现,服务消费,服务保护与熔断,网关,分布式调用追踪,分布式配置管理等。 Spring Cloud是一个基于Spring Boot实现的云应用开发工具;Spring boot专注于快速、方便集成的单个个体,Spring Cloud是关注全局的服务治理框架,它将Sp...
1、详细的SpringBoot和SpringCloud对应的关系: Spring官方对应关系 2、springCloud与各组件的版本对应关系 官方文档
图Spring Cloud与Spring Boot版本的对应关系 Spring Cloud不是一个组件,而是许多组件的集合。它的版本命名比较特殊,是由以A到Z为首字母的一些单词组成的。 Spring Boot整合Spring Cloud需要在POM文件中添加对应版本的Spring Cloud的依赖, <parent> <groupId>org.springframework.boot</groupId> ...
1、Spring boot 是 Spring (AOP和IOC)的一套快速配置脚手架,可以基于spring boot 快速开发单个微服务; Spring Cloud是一个基于Spring Boot实现的云应用开发工具;Spring Cloud是多个Spring boot微服务的集合,当然不是简单的集合,那么就涉及到微服务的七大原则: ...
在搭建SpringCloud项目环境架构的时候,需要选择SpringBoot和SpringCloud进行兼容的版本号,因此对于选择SpringBoot版本与SpringCloud版本的对应关系很重要,如果版本关系不对应,常见的会遇见项目启动不起来,怪异的则会是你的项目出现一些诡异的问题,查资料也不好查。下面就收集一下SpringBoot与SpringCloud版本之间的对应关系,在...
Spring Boot集成了非常高效的监控框架,只要简单引入对spring-boot-start-actuator的依赖,就可以实现对服务性能的监控。结合Spring Cloud就可以实现对整个微服务链路的全天候监控 Spring Cloud并没有重复制造轮子,它只是将目前各家公司开发的比较成熟、经得起实际考验的服务框架组合起来,通过Spring Boot风格进行再封装屏蔽掉了...
1. SpringBoot专注于快速、方便的开发单个微服务个体;SpringCloud关注全局的服务治理框架。它将SpringBoot开发的一个个单体微服务整合并管理起来,为各个微服务之间提供,配置管理、服务发现、断路器、路由、事件总线、全局锁、决策竞选、分布式会话等等集成服务。 2. SpringBoot并没有重复制造轮子,它只是将目前各家公司开发...